Transaction 690b21d19f803815c917804de9636e7455a7a495df81795b225d8ca425f71d87
1 Input
1 Output
-
690b21d19f803815c917804de9636e7455a7a495df81795b225d8ca425f71d87:0
- value
- 2000965
- script pubkey
- OP_0 OP_PUSHBYTES_20 795e01a593c0d89cbaf5d6b4f132718f0b3eb8d6
- address
- bc1q090qrfvncrvfewh46660zvn33u9nawxkuntxe2